RTO Road Tax Calculator 2026 — Car & Bike Tax by State in India
Road Tax, officially called Motor Vehicle Tax, is a one-time levy collected by your state's Regional Transport Office (RTO) when you register a new car or two-wheeler. Unlike GST, which is charged uniformly across the country, road tax is a state subject — meaning the exact same car can attract a road tax bill that is two or three times higher in one state compared to another. The rate is generally applied as a percentage of the vehicle's ex-showroom price, and it typically covers the vehicle for its full registration life of fifteen years for private, non-transport vehicles.
This free calculator lets you estimate road tax for both cars and two-wheelers across all Indian states and Union Territories, compare rates side-by-side if you are deciding where to register, and estimate your full on-road price by adding registration fees, hypothecation charges (if the vehicle is financed), and an approximate insurance premium on top of the ex-showroom price. States such as Himachal Pradesh, Dadra & Nagar Haveli, Sikkim, and Puducherry consistently rank among the cheapest for vehicle registration, while Karnataka, Maharashtra, and Kerala tend to charge some of the highest rates, particularly for vehicles above ten lakh rupees. Most states also offer a meaningfully reduced or fully exempt road tax rate on electric vehicles as part of their EV adoption push — our EV Tax Savings tab shows exactly how much that concession is worth in rupees for your specific state and vehicle price.
Keep in mind that road tax is only one part of your total RTO charges — registration fees, hypothecation charges on financed vehicles, HSRP number plate charges, and applicable cesses add further to the bill. If you relocate to another state and keep your vehicle for more than twelve months, you are legally required to have it re-registered and pay fresh road tax there, unless you hold a Bharat Series (BH-series) plate, which allows a flat one-time tax valid nationwide. FAQ — RTO Road Tax Calculator 2026
What is road tax and who collects it? ▾
Road tax, also called Motor Vehicle Tax or Lifetime Tax, is a one-time tax collected by your state's Regional Transport Office (RTO) when you register a new vehicle. It grants legal permission to use public roads and is typically valid for 15 years for private vehicles. It is separate from GST, which is already included in the ex-showroom price.
Why does road tax differ so much between states? ▾
Road tax is a State subject under India's Constitution, so each state government sets its own rates through its Motor Vehicles Taxation Act. States balance revenue needs, infrastructure spending, and vehicle affordability differently, which is why the same car can cost tens of thousands of rupees more or less depending on where it is registered.
Is road tax calculated on ex-showroom price or on-road price? ▾
Road tax is calculated on the ex-showroom price (before insurance and other on-road additions) in most states. A few states like Gujarat, Chandigarh, and Jharkhand calculate it on the pre-GST invoice value instead, which lowers the effective tax base. Dealer discounts and exchange bonuses are not deducted before calculating road tax.
Do electric vehicles get road tax exemption? ▾
Most Indian states offer significantly reduced or fully exempt road tax on electric vehicles to encourage EV adoption, often 0-4% compared to 6-20% for petrol or diesel vehicles. Some states cap this exemption to EVs below a certain price or offer it only for a limited period, so always check your state's current EV policy.
What is BH-series registration and does it save on road tax? ▾
Bharat Series (BH-series) registration lets eligible buyers — government/PSU employees and private-sector employees with offices in 4+ states — pay a flat, one-time road tax nationwide instead of re-paying it every time they relocate between states. It removes the need to re-register when moving states, which is a major saving for frequently transferred employees.
Do I have to pay road tax again if I move to another state? ▾
Yes. If you keep your vehicle in another state for more than 12 months, motor vehicle rules require you to obtain a No Objection Certificate (NOC) from your original RTO and re-register in the new state, paying fresh road tax there (often with a depreciation-based reduction for the vehicle's age). BH-series registration avoids this requirement entirely.
Is diesel road tax higher than petrol? ▾
In several states, yes — diesel vehicles attract a small additional surcharge (commonly 1-3 percentage points) on top of the base road tax rate, reflecting their higher emissions profile. Some states apply no differential at all. Our calculator applies each state's typical diesel surcharge where applicable.
